Understanding the Basics: What is Remote IoT VPC SSH?
First things first, let’s break down the acronym soup. Remote IoT VPC SSH might sound intimidating, but trust me, it’s simpler than it looks. IoT stands for Internet of Things, which refers to all those smart devices connected to the internet. VPC, or Virtual Private Cloud, is essentially a secure cloud-based network where you can host and manage your IoT devices. And SSH? That’s Secure Shell, a protocol that lets you remotely access and manage devices securely.
Now, when we talk about downloading and configuring these elements on Windows 10, we’re talking about setting up a secure environment where you can control your IoT devices without compromising security. It’s like giving yourself a backstage pass to your digital empire, but with extra layers of protection.

Setting Up Your Windows 10 Machine for Remote IoT VPC SSH
Alright, let’s get our hands dirty. The first step in mastering remote IoT VPC SSH is setting up your Windows 10 machine properly. Here’s how you can do it:
Step 1: Install OpenSSH on Windows 10
Windows 10 comes with OpenSSH pre-installed, but you might need to enable it. Here’s how:
- Open the Start menu and go to Settings > Apps > Optional Features.
- Click on Add a feature and search for OpenSSH Client.
- Install the OpenSSH Client and Server if you plan to manage devices remotely.
Boom! You’ve just armed your Windows 10 machine with the tools it needs to handle SSH like a pro.
Step 2: Configure Your VPC
Now that you’ve got SSH ready, it’s time to set up your Virtual Private Cloud. Here’s a quick rundown:
- Choose a cloud provider like AWS, Google Cloud, or Azure.
- Create a VPC and configure subnets, routing tables, and security groups.
- Ensure your IoT devices are connected to the VPC and can communicate securely.
Think of your VPC as the digital fortress protecting your IoT devices. The better you configure it, the safer your setup will be.
Connecting to IoT Devices via SSH
With everything set up, it’s time to connect to your IoT devices using SSH. Here’s how:
- Open the Command Prompt or PowerShell on your Windows 10 machine.
- Type
ssh username@ip_address
, replacingusername
andip_address
with your device’s details. - Enter the password when prompted, and voila! You’re in.

Troubleshooting Common Issues
Let’s be real, tech stuff doesn’t always go as planned. Here are some common issues you might face and how to fix them:
- Connection Refused: Double-check your IP address and ensure the SSH service is running on your device.
- Authentication Failed: Verify your username and password. If you’re using keys, ensure they’re correctly configured.
- Timeout Errors: This could be a firewall issue. Make sure the necessary ports are open and accessible.
Troubleshooting is all about staying calm and methodical. Take it step by step, and you’ll be back in business in no time.
Best Practices for Secure IoT VPC SSH Management
Security should always be at the forefront of your mind when dealing with IoT devices. Here are some best practices to keep your setup safe:
- Use strong, unique passwords or SSH keys for authentication.
- Regularly update your devices and software to patch vulnerabilities.
- Limit access to your VPC and SSH by configuring strict security groups.
